Home Invasion Crew Indicted in Gwinnett County

ATLANTA—Special Agent in Charge (SAC) J. Britt Johnson, FBI Atlanta, along with Gwinnett County Police Chief A.A. (Butch) Ayers, announces the following indictments at Gwinnett County, Georgia.

On April 20, 2016, a Gwinnett County Grand Jury indicted Lamon Jackson, age 46, Jarvis Levoyd Tucker, age 45, Jason Jermoine Tucker, age 36, and Darden Bernard Walker, age 28, all from Atlanta, on state charges related to their alleged participation in a September 2011 armed home invasion of a jewelry store owner.

Both Jarvis and Jason Tucker, along with Darden Walker, were previously arrested by FBI agents and Gwinnett County Police Department officers in a separate matter wherein they were alleged to be conspiring to rob a jewelry store owner at his residence.

Following his indictment, Jackson was subsequently arrested by FBI agents and Atlanta Police officers at a residence in the 400 block of Highland Avenue, N.E., Atlanta, Georgia, without incident.

The above defendants could face additional federal charges.

All of the above defendants remain in custody at the Gwinnett County Detention Facility.

The public should be reminded that the above are allegations and that all persons are to be considered innocent until proven guilty in a court of law.
